Skip to main content
Alerting & Response/Alert Events
GETAlertingSince 1.0SynchronousAuth Required

ListAlertEvents

List alert events with filtering by severity, state, time range, and more

Execution Availability

Try It Out

Submit a mock request using the current auth context and example-driven inputs.

Query Parameters

Request Inputs

Query Parameters

  • severityString

    Filter by severity level Filter by severity level

  • stateString

    Filter by event state Filter by event state

  • resourceTypeString

    Filter by resource type Filter by resource type

  • ruleUuidString

    Filter by rule UUID Filter by rule UUID

  • sourceString

    Filter by event source Filter by event source

Responses

200 OK

On success, this API returns the following response structure.

  • itemsList

    List of alert events

    Example: (nested array)

    • uuidString

      Unique identifier of the alert event

      Example: event-001

    • ruleUuidString

      UUID of the rule that generated this event

      Example: rule-abc123

    • ruleNameString

      Name of the rule that generated this event

      Example: High CPU Usage

    • resourceTypeString

      Type of monitored resource

      Example: vm

    • resourceUuidString

      UUID of the specific resource

      Example: res-abc123

    • metricNameString

      Metric name that was evaluated

      Example: cpu_usage_percent

    • currentValueLong

      Current metric value at the time of the event

      Example: 95.3

    • thresholdLong

      Threshold that was exceeded

      Example: 90

    • operatorString

      Comparison operator used

      Example: >

    • severityString

      Severity level of the event

      Example: critical

    • stateString

      Current state: firing, acknowledged, or resolved

      Example: firing

    • messageString

      Human-readable event message

      Example: CPU usage is 95.3%

    • fingerprintString

      Unique fingerprint for deduplication

      Example: fp-abc123

    • sourceString

      Source system that generated the event

      Example: prometheus

    • notifiedAtString

      Timestamp when the notification was sent

      Example: 2026-01-15T08:00:00Z

    • resolvedAtString

      Timestamp when the event was resolved

      Example: 2026-01-15T08:00:00Z

    • acknowledgedByString

      User who acknowledged this event

      Example: admin

    • acknowledgedAtString

      Timestamp when the event was acknowledged

      Example: 2026-01-15T08:00:00Z

    • createDateString

      Timestamp when the event was created

      Example: 2026-01-15T08:00:00Z

  • totalInteger

    Total number of matching events

    Example: 150

  • limitInteger

    Maximum items per page

    Example: 20

  • offsetInteger

    Offset from start of result set

    Example: 20

Endpoint

GET/api/v1/alerting/events

/api/v1/alerting/events

Operation ID

ListAlertEvents

Permalink

Request Example

curl -X GET '{host}/api/v1/alerting/events' -H 'Authorization: Bearer {token}'

Response Example

200
{
  "items": [
    {}
  ],
  "total": 150,
  "limit": 20,
  "offset": 20
}

Change History

This API has no change history records yet.

View all change history